Trip Overview

Traveling from Dale to Hammond covers 291.4 miles across the heart of Indiana, making for a straightforward trek through the Midwest. You should plan on a drive time of approximately 5 hours and 35 minutes, which is manageable as a single-day trip if you are comfortable with a full day behind the wheel. Budget about $44 for fuel to complete the journey. The route primarily utilizes I-65 and I-69, ensuring you stay on major thoroughfares for the vast majority of your travel. Because this is a highway-focused drive, it offers efficiency over local sightseeing, making it ideal for those prioritizing arrival time. Whether you are heading north for business or leisure, this path provides a reliable, direct connection between these two Indiana points.

What kind of drive is this?

This trip is defined by its efficiency, with 83% of your travel occurring on high-speed highways. You will experience a significant stretch of open road, including a longest uninterrupted segment of 134.7 miles on I-65. The journey begins with local navigation on Newton Street before transitioning into the steady pace of the interstate system. Expect a consistent, interstate-heavy experience that demands focus but offers a predictable rhythm. As you move from the southern part of the state toward the northern region, the road character remains largely uniform, focusing on speed and connectivity rather than winding backroads or technical terrain.
